Two charged over assault on tradies in Lara

Two men have been charged after an alleged home invasion and assault in Lara.

It’s alleged five male offenders approached two male tradies working at a Sparrowhawk Avenue property on Monday 13 April, entering the building and assaulting the pair with weapons after a confrontation.

The men, aged 35 and 36, were hospitalised with serious but non-life-threatening injuries, while the offenders fled the scene.

After executing search warrants in Hoppers Crossing on Tuesday morning, police arrested and interviewed a 34-year-old man and a 44-year-old man.

They were charged with offences including aggravated home invasion and intentionally causing serious injury in circumstances of gross violence.

Detectives believe three offenders are still yet to be located, with the investigation ongoing.
